Dock construction services involve designing, building, and installing docks that extend from the shoreline into bodies of water. These services typically encompass the selection of appropriate materials, site preparation, and assembly of the dock structure to ensure stability and durability. Contractors may also customize designs to fit specific property layouts and user needs, providing options for floating docks, stationary docks, or modular systems. The goal is to create a functional and reliable platform that allows for easy access to boats, watercraft, or recreational activities.
One of the primary problems dock construction helps address is the need for a stable and safe platform over water, especially in areas where natural shoreline conditions are uneven or subject to change. Properly constructed docks can prevent issues such as shifting, sinking, or damage caused by water levels and weather conditions. Additionally, a well-built dock can improve access for boaters, enhance the usability of waterfront properties, and help prevent erosion or damage to the shoreline by providing a designated area for watercraft and activities.

The overview below groups typical Dock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Macomb,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of materials for dock construction typically ranges from $1,500 to $10,000, depending on the type and quality of materials used. For example, basic pressure-treated wood may cost around $1,500, while premium composite options can exceed $8,000.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for dock construction generally fall between $2,000 and $15,000. Factors influencing these costs include dock size, complexity, and local labor rates in Macomb, MI and nearby areas.
Permitting and Inspection Fees - Permitting and inspection fees can vary from $200 to $1,500, depending on local regulations and the scope of the project. These fees cover necessary approvals to ensure compliance with local building codes.
Additional Features - Adding features such as railings, lighting, or boat lifts can increase overall costs by $1,000 to $5,000. The final price depends on the selected options and their compl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
